From dbb32b03beee258af9d843d6ab530d5b4efc80d8 Mon Sep 17 00:00:00 2001 From: Thomas Goirand Date: Tue, 6 May 2014 23:02:15 +0800 Subject: [PATCH] Sets /etc/ceilometer/pipeline.yaml as conffile and remove handling from the from maintainer scripts (Closes: #747216). Change-Id: Ie379cdc02b00c6be90231a9d9ce9d7aeaee2d06d Rewritten-From: 1306ae33e55d86cb416960b41887a559e97ee256 --- xenial/debian/ceilometer-common.install | 1 + xenial/debian/ceilometer-common.postinst.in | 1 - xenial/debian/ceilometer-common.postrm | 1 - xenial/debian/changelog | 7 +++++++ xenial/debian/rules | 1 - 5 files changed, 8 insertions(+), 3 deletions(-) diff --git a/xenial/debian/ceilometer-common.install b/xenial/debian/ceilometer-common.install index 1301660..3fa046a 100644 --- a/xenial/debian/ceilometer-common.install +++ b/xenial/debian/ceilometer-common.install @@ -1,3 +1,4 @@ /usr/bin/ceilometer-dbsync /usr/bin/ceilometer-expirer tools/show_data.py usr/share/doc/ceilometer +etc/ceilometer/pipeline.yaml /etc/ceilometer diff --git a/xenial/debian/ceilometer-common.postinst.in b/xenial/debian/ceilometer-common.postinst.in index a8fb13a..63ad73f 100644 --- a/xenial/debian/ceilometer-common.postinst.in +++ b/xenial/debian/ceilometer-common.postinst.in @@ -44,7 +44,6 @@ if [ "$1" = "configure" ] || [ "$1" = "reconfigure" ] ; then pkgos_write_new_conf ceilometer ceilometer.conf pkgos_write_new_conf ceilometer policy.json pkgos_write_new_conf ceilometer sources.json - pkgos_write_new_conf ceilometer pipeline.yaml pkgos_rabbit_write_conf /etc/ceilometer/ceilometer.conf DEFAULT ceilometer pkgos_write_admin_creds /etc/ceilometer/ceilometer.conf keystone_authtoken ceilometer ceilometer-dbsync || true diff --git a/xenial/debian/ceilometer-common.postrm b/xenial/debian/ceilometer-common.postrm index 534c9a9..ec814f8 100644 --- a/xenial/debian/ceilometer-common.postrm +++ b/xenial/debian/ceilometer-common.postrm @@ -6,7 +6,6 @@ if [ "${1}" = "purge" ] ; then rm -f /etc/ceilometer/ceilometer.conf rm -f /etc/ceilometer/policy.json rm -f /etc/ceilometer/sources.json - rm -f /etc/ceilometer/pipeline.yaml rmdir --ignore-fail-on-non-empty /etc/ceilometer || true rmdir --ignore-fail-on-non-empty /var/lib/nova/cache || true rmdir --ignore-fail-on-non-empty /var/lib/nova || true diff --git a/xenial/debian/changelog b/xenial/debian/changelog index 69a8e77..62198bf 100644 --- a/xenial/debian/changelog +++ b/xenial/debian/changelog @@ -1,3 +1,10 @@ +ceilometer (2014.1-3) unstable; urgency=medium + + * Sets /etc/ceilometer/pipeline.yaml as conffile and remove handling from the + from maintainer scripts (Closes: #747216). + + -- Thomas Goirand Tue, 06 May 2014 23:00:59 +0800 + ceilometer (2014.1-2) unstable; urgency=medium * Fixed long description typo (Closes: #745321). diff --git a/xenial/debian/rules b/xenial/debian/rules index d939044..0347473 100755 --- a/xenial/debian/rules +++ b/xenial/debian/rules @@ -20,7 +20,6 @@ override_dh_install: install -D -m 0644 $(CURDIR)/etc/ceilometer/ceilometer.conf.sample $(CURDIR)/debian/ceilometer-common/usr/share/ceilometer-common/ceilometer.conf install -D -m 0644 $(CURDIR)/etc/ceilometer/policy.json $(CURDIR)/debian/ceilometer-common/usr/share/ceilometer-common/policy.json install -D -m 0644 $(CURDIR)/etc/ceilometer/sources.json $(CURDIR)/debian/ceilometer-common/usr/share/ceilometer-common/sources.json - install -D -m 0644 $(CURDIR)/etc/ceilometer/pipeline.yaml $(CURDIR)/debian/ceilometer-common/usr/share/ceilometer-common/pipeline.yaml override_dh_auto_build: dh_auto_build -- 2.32.3